Sumario:From its origins in India over two thousand years ago, Buddhism has spread throughout Asia and is now exerting an increasing influence on Western culture. In clear and straightforward language, and with the help of maps, diagrams and illustrations, this book explains how Buddhism began and how it evolved into its present day form. The central teachings and practices are set out clearly, and key topics such as karma and rebirth, meditation, ethics and Buddhism in the West, receive detailed coverage.
